Some Results about Dissipativity of Kolmogorov OperatorsCzechoslovak Mathematical Journal - Tập 51 - Trang 685-699 - 2001
Giuseppe Da Prato, Luciano Tubaro
Given a Hilbert space H with a Borel probability measure ν, we prove the m-dissipativity in L
1(H, ν) of a Kolmogorov operator K that is a perturbation, not necessarily of gradient type, of an Ornstein-Uhlenbeck operator.

Asymptotics of variance of the lattice point countCzechoslovak Mathematical Journal - Tập 58 - Trang 751-758 - 2008
Jiří Janáček
The variance of the number of lattice points inside the dilated bounded set rD with random position in ℝ
d
has asymptotics ∼ r
d−1 if the rotational average of the squared modulus of the Fourier transform of the set is O(ϰ
−d−1). The asymptotics follow from Wiener’s Tauberian theorem.
On the Stieltjes moment problem on semigroupsCzechoslovak Mathematical Journal - - 2002
Torben Maack Bisgaard
We characterize finitely generated abelian semigroups such that every completely positive definite function (a function all of whose shifts are positive definite) is an integral of nonnegative miltiplicative real-valued functions (called nonnegative characters).

Properties of differences of meromorphic functionsCzechoslovak Mathematical Journal - Tập 61 - Trang 213-224 - 2011
Zong-Xuan Chen, Kwang Ho Shon
Let f be a transcendental meromorphic function. We propose a number of results concerning zeros and fixed points of the difference g(z) = f(z + c) − f(z) and the divided difference g(z)/f(z).
